What is the most advanced coding language?

What is the Most Advanced Coding Language?

Definition of “Advanced”

When discussing the most advanced coding language, it’s important to first define what is meant by “advanced.” In this context, advanced is a term used to describe programming languages that possess features that make coding easier and faster than traditional languages. These features can include object-oriented programming, memory management, garbage collection, modern libraries, and many more.

Popular Advanced Programming Languages

Some of the most popular advanced coding languages include Python, Java, C#, and Swift. These languages provide a range of benefits, and have become popular choices among coders.

Python is a general-purpose language that can be used for a variety of tasks and is suitable for beginners and experienced coders alike. It has a user-friendly syntax and a range of libraries, making it a great choice for rapid development. Java is another great choice and is widely used for enterprise applications. It offers a powerful object-oriented programming model and powerful debugging tools. C# is a multi-paradigm language that is used to build enterprise-grade applications. It is highly expressive and offers a range of features for coding complex applications. Finally, Swift is a powerful language used for developing apps for Apple’s platforms. It combines the powerful features of Objective-C and C++, making it the language of choice for many iOS developers.

Conclusion

As there is no singular definition of “advanced,” it is difficult to say which coding language is definitively the most advanced. However, the four languages listed above – Python, Java, C#, and Swift – are some of the most popular advanced coding languages, and are used by developers to create powerful and sophisticated applications.

Which is slowest programming language?

Scripting Language

Scripting languages such as Shell, Python, and JavaScript tend to be somewhat slower than compiled languages like C, Java, and Go, due to the fact that they are interpreted at runtime. This means that, rather than being compiled into a machine-readable code, the code is read and executed line-by-line. This can lead to slower execution time, as compared to compiled languages, which are already in a machine-readable form.

Interpreted Language

Interpreted languages are similar to scripting languages in that they are read and executed line-by-line at runtime. However, they are generally slower than scripting languages due to the extra overhead of interpreting the code. Languages such as BASIC and Visual Basic are interpreted languages and tend to be slower than scripting languages.

Assembly Language

Finally, assembly language is the slowest language of all, as it requires manual translation into machine code prior to execution. Assembly language is very low-level and difficult to understand, so it can take longer to translate and execute. As a result, it is not suitable for most applications and is generally only used in specific situations where speed is not the primary concern.

Is Netflix built on Ruby on Rails?

Is Netflix Built on Ruby on Rails?

Background of Netflix

Netflix is a streaming entertainment service founded in 1997. It is one of the most popular streaming services and is available in over 190 countries. The service offers movies, documentaries, and television shows.

What is Ruby on Rails?

Ruby on Rails (RoR) is an open-source web application framework written in the Ruby programming language. It is designed to make development faster and easier by providing developers with a wide range of tools and libraries.

Is Netflix Built on Ruby on Rails?

No, Netflix is not built on Ruby on Rails. Netflix is built on an open source software called Zuul. Zuul is an edge service that provides dynamic routing, monitoring, security, and more to Netflix’s applications. Netflix also uses a range of other technologies, such as Python and Node.js, to power its streaming service.

Is GitHub still using Rails?

Understanding What Rails Is

Rails is an open-source web application framework created using the Ruby programming language. It is designed to make development easier by simplifying common tasks such as database communication, file uploading, and creating forms.

GitHub’s Use of Rails

GitHub is a web-based code hosting service and a popular platform for developers to collaborate on open-source projects. GitHub is built on top of Rails, with GitHub engineers actively contributing to the framework. GitHub has been using Rails since 2008 and the team is dedicated to continuing to use Rails for its web stack and for its API.

Who still uses Ruby on Rails?

Overview of Ruby on Rails

Ruby on Rails is an open-source web application framework written in the Ruby programming language. It is designed to simplify the creation of database-backed web applications. It’s simple, efficient syntax and philosophy of coding, has made it one of the most popular web development frameworks currently in use.

Who Uses Ruby on Rails?

Given its simplicity and flexibility, Ruby on Rails is used by a wide variety of organizations, from small startups to large enterprises. It is particularly popular among web developers for its speed, scalability, and cost-effectiveness.

Some of the more well-known companies that use Ruby on Rails include Airbnb, GitHub, Shopify, Hulu, Twitch, and SoundCloud. In addition, many startups, especially those in the tech industry, are using the framework to quickly develop their applications.

Conclusion

Ruby on Rails is still used by many companies and organizations today. While it is particularly popular among tech startups and web developers, a wide variety of organizations are taking advantage of the framework’s advantages. As its popularity continues to grow, it’s likely that Ruby on Rails will become even more widely used in the future.

Leave a Comment